Customized "Deal Cards" in Deals Dashboard

I'd like to be able to control which properties appear on the "card view" in the

 

Deals Dashboard. Default is...
- Deal Name
- Amount
- Close Date
- Attached Contacts

 

I'd like to be able to select my own 4 attributes, so that the at-a-glance feature is more meaningful to me.

 

In addition I'd like to be able to color-code Deal Cards based on attributes. (i.e. [if deal amount > $5,000; then color = green])

Since posting this it has seen a lot of upvotes (Thanks!) and support. 

 

Since one of the most commented-on frustration is the inability to edit the close date, I thought I would share my work-around:

 

Since the last update, you can require fields to be updated when moving a deal from stage to stage (pipeline settings).  I now require the Close Date field to be updated in order to move a deal to a new stage.

 

Even though it's not the original goal of the request (allow us to update which fields are shown on the Deal summary card in Board view, at least stages and deals are sorted by the (previously useless) Close Date, which informs my Deal Forecast report.
